Treasury of Scripture Knowledge
1Sa 14:8 — Then said Jonathan, Behold, we will pass over unto [these] men, and we will discover ourselves unto them.
Correlating Passages
  
  
|
Jdg 7:9 |
And it came to pass the same night, that the LORD said unto him, Arise, get thee down unto the host; for I have delivered it into thine hand. |
  
  
|
Jdg 7:10 |
But if thou fear to go down, go thou with Phurah thy servant down to the host: |
  
  
|
Jdg 7:11 |
And thou shalt hear what they say; and afterward shall thine hands be strengthened to go down unto the host. Then went he down with Phurah his servant unto the outside of the armed men that [were] in the host. |
  
  
|
Jdg 7:12 |
And the Midianites and the Amalekites and all the children of the east lay along in the valley like grasshoppers for multitude; and their camels [were] without number, as the sand by the sea side for multitude. |
  
  
|
Jdg 7:13 |
And when Gideon was come, behold, [there was] a man that told a dream unto his fellow, and said, Behold, I dreamed a dream, and, lo, a cake of barley bread tumbled into the host of Midian, and came unto a tent, and smote it that it fell, and overturned it, that the tent lay along. |
  
  
|
Jdg 7:14 |
And his fellow answered and said, This [is] nothing else save the sword of Gideon the son of Joash, a man of Israel: [for] into his hand hath God delivered Midian, and all the host. |
